请问c语言中char的值为-52的含义

日期:2021-08-03 02:09:35 人气:1

请问c语言中char的值为-52的含义

内容为数字的char,包含
0,1,2,3,4,5,6,7,8,9
共计10个字符。
这十个字符在存为字符型时,其存储值为对应的ascii码,而这些ascii码是连续的,且按照其本身数字的大小来排列。
这样就可以将字符值,减去起始ascii码值实现转为对应值的效果。

int
a;
//转换的目标变量。
char
c
=
'7';
/
    A+
热门评论